The July 2025 Nevada Gaming Commission Meeting highlighted significant developments in the licensing of gaming establishments in the state. A key discussion centered around the approval of a second location for Elvira, a gaming entity that operates under the ownership of Black 55 and Red Global. This location has a history of being licensed under the same landlord and neighbor, indicating a stable operational environment.
Mister Feinstein, who has previously served as the member manager for Red Global, was noted for his ongoing involvement in the licensing process. Additionally, Mister Lamson has submitted an application for licensure as a key employee, which is a crucial step in ensuring that the management team meets regulatory standards.
The commission confirmed that all conditions related to this licensing application have been successfully met, paving the way for the new location to commence operations. This approval reflects the commission's commitment to maintaining a regulated and responsible gaming environment in Nevada.
